The board’s most important role is to employ the superintendent and treasurer and work closely with them to establish and set policy, vision and long-range goals and be accountable for the fiscal health and opportunities provided to the district’s students and families. School boards adopt policy and oversee the district’s policy manual. ![]() It is important that the board serves as a positive and responsible liaison between the school district and community. The broadest definition of a school board’s role is that it acts as the governance team for the school district. Ohio’s public school board members, one of the largest groups of elected officials in the state, are charged with one of the major responsibilities in government - to provide the best educational opportunities possible for the youth of Ohio and to manage and control the political subdivision of the school district.
